Back to the topic. Yesterday a Nairalander by name Saliman22 posted an ad that he wants to sell his iPhone 6plus for 45,000k shocked shocked shocked. As a wise Nigerian, when u see that type of ad the first thing that comes to ur mind is SCAM. So when I opened the thread yesterday very body who commented on the post were abusing the guy, calling him all sort of names, but the guy was busy replying all of them one buy one telling them he is not a scam but non believed him. He even posted his Facebook names house address and and all but trust Nigerians the abuse kept coming. I decided to go through the guys profile and noticed he registered as a member in March 13 2012. I said to myself hmmm this guy is not new here so maybe his genuine after all. So I decided to check his posts and I noticed that on the 28 of October 2015 he posted something about how to on data on iPhone and on November 3rd he posted again iPhone problem how to download music on iPhone. With this 2 posts on different dates I came to a conclusion that maybe this guy really does have this iPhone 6plus but maybe can't cope with the stress of using laptop to put song and videos if he can't download them. So to cut the long story short I picked up my phone and call the guy and asked him why he want to sell iPhone 6plus for that amount he said nothing that he needed money urgently that's why. And I said hmmm bro even if u needed money there is a price u will put it an people won't abuse u like they are doing, but he maintained his stance that he is real. I then ask him if the phone is having problems or if it's a clone he said no but that there is a crack on the screen. An I said oh that's why he said that the crack is not even much that I won't notice it unless I put it up close. When all this argument was going on I noticed that the 2 thread he opened about the iPhone has bn close by the mod lol. I it sounds too good to be true....so I asked the guy to send me the pictures of the iPhone serial number and all which he did on WhatsApp. I check the serial number and it's confirmed from Apple website that it's iPhone 6plus with 1 year warranty to end February 2016. I checked the icloud lock and found out its on. But from the pics he sent me I saw his icloud apple id with his email setup there. I went back to Nairaland a search his post again I saw sometime in 2012 he asked someone to contact him with the email address I cross checked it with the one on th iPhone the same thing. While I was doing my investigation each time I call him all he keep telling me is he is not a scam that if come to akwa ibom to pick the phone I should go to any police station and call him h will come there and transact with me that he is not a scam. Finally yesterday evening around 6pm I called him again and told him if he is broke and need money that he should send his account number I will send him 5k on 2nd or 3rd when banks will reopon that I don't want him to to stress m in coming to akwa ibom and I will be disappointed and I will disgrace him on Facebook and Nairaland. He still affirmed he is not a scammer. So right now am in a bus going to akwa ibom to meet this guy.
